12 Nashville restaurants scored 70 or lower in February health reports
Airfind news item
By Mackensy Lunsford
Published on March 9, 2026.
The Tennessee Department of Health conducted 1,974 inspections of restaurants, food trucks, and other establishments in the area in February, with 49% of them receiving perfect scores. However, not all of these restaurants performed well, with a score of 70 or lower on initial inspections.
